Course Description: 

Teaching and Supporting Young Children with Significant Special Needs

Speaker: Linda Blum, Special Ed. Teacher, Education Behavior Specialist, Coach, Independent Contractor, and Mom of a child with special needs has over 25 years of experience involved in the world of Special Needs Education in a variety of Education Programs with students, teachers and administrators all over the Bay Area. She is also a parent raising a child with special needs! Linda is passionate about helping young children achieve their goals in inclusive settings, by providing the tools needed to support behavior and learning differences. It is also her passion to help teachers feel confident and comfortable teaching to all types of learners.

In this Webinar, you will learn about:

  • Early Intervention Programs
  • The Homeschool Connection
  • Accessing Resources

This Zoom webinar series is offered for FIRST 5 Partners and other local professionals such as Early interventionists, Social Workers, Home Visitors, Childcare and Preschool providers, Family Resource Center staff, Therapeutic Service Providers, and Parents too!
